Stranger Things S1 E3, “Holly, Jolly”, scores 2/5 for violence, 2/5 for sex and 3/5 for language, for an overall kid-rating of 3/5 — Preview first — about 11+. An increasingly concerned Nancy looks for Barb and finds out what Jonathan's been up to. Joyce is convinced Will is trying to talk to her.

Across the episode we counted 9 flagged moments in 3 themes: Sex & hookups (2); Violence & injury (1); Swearing (6). Every moment below is either a direct quote from the episode transcript or a short description of what happens on screen, so you can decide before you press play.
